The Nigerian Railway Corporation has declared free train ride for Nigeria
The Managing Director of the Nigeria Railway Corporation, Fidet Okhiria made this known while relating to the special assistant to the president on digital communication, Tolu Ogunlesi during the test drive.
Okhiria made it known that Nigerians will have the opportunity to travel from Iju in Lagos to Abeokuta for free using the new train for about a month starting from next month.
